Nous utilisons des cookies pour vous garantir la meilleure expérience sur notre site. Si vous continuez à utiliser ce dernier, nous considèrerons que vous acceptez l'utilisation des cookies. J'ai compris ! ou En savoir plus !.
banniere

Le portail francophone de la géomatique


Toujours pas inscrit ? Mot de passe oublié ?
Nom d'utilisateur    Mot de passe              Toujours pas inscrit ?   Mot de passe oublié ?

Annonce

GeoDataDays 2025

#1 Wed 21 May 2025 17:05

conejo
Participant assidu
Lieu: Lunel
Date d'inscription: 2 Dec 2005
Messages: 1700

Compter un caractère

Bonjour,

J'ai une liste de propriétaires séparés un tiret ( - ).
Afin de compter le nombre de propriétaires, il me suffirait de compter le nombre de tirets dans la cellule.
Comment faire pour compter ce nombre de tirets?
Merci.

Hors ligne

 

#2 Wed 21 May 2025 17:37

Loic_GR
Membre
Lieu: Besancon
Date d'inscription: 12 May 2011
Messages: 1029
Site web

Re: Compter un caractère

Bonjour, j'adore le challenge !

StringSearcher avec l'expression régulière \-, puis demander de créer une liste dans le paramètrage Avancé > Liste correspondance complète suivi d'un ListeElementCounter qui compte la liste créée

Testé chez moi > ok :-)


Freelance traitements ETL FME certifié: www.sitdi-france.fr Twitter : @sitdifrance
Site perso ~ www.partir-en-vtt.com

Hors ligne

 

#3 Wed 21 May 2025 17:50

conejo
Participant assidu
Lieu: Lunel
Date d'inscription: 2 Dec 2005
Messages: 1700

Re: Compter un caractère

Bonjour Loic_GR cela fonctionne, merci.
De mon côté, j'ai utilisé attributesplitter qui est mieux à mon sens.
En effet, avec StringSearcher, si il y par exemple 5 tirets, il comptera effectivement 5 mais en réalité c'est 6
Soit les propriétaires
A - B - C - D - E - F, cela donne 5 mais en réalité cela fait 6 propriétaires.
Avec Attributesplitter, je ne sais pas comment mais il compte 6 propriétaires.

Merci

Hors ligne

 

Pied de page des forums

Copyright Association GeoRezo